Methods : A 57-year old female, with a T4 (invasion of the abdominal wall) adenocarcinoma in the splenic flexure was submitted to robotic left angulectomy. A simplified docking was conducted as standardized by Bianchi et al (01) and is shown on figure 1 . Intracorporeal Kono-S anastomosis was performed. The patient had a good postoperative recovery and was discharged on the second postoperative day Conclusion : robotic colorectal surgery for cancer is safe and feasible using the novel Hugo RAS System.
